Biography
I am a retina specialist dedicated to revolutionizing the diagnosis and treatment of retinal diseases. With a passionate focus on finding cures for inherited retinal conditions such as retinitis pigmentosa and Stargardt disease, including gene therapy and stem cell replacement therapy.
I am committed to advancing diagnostic capabilities through innovative applications of machine learning and image processing techniques to enhance early detection and personalized treatment strategies for patients with retinal disorders.
I am director of the IRD fellowship at the Duke Eye Center and hope to train the next generation of IRD specialists.
